Jerusalem Artichoke
This root vegetable contains inulin, a prebiotic fiber that helps feed probiotic bacteria in the gut to balance the microbiome. It supports digestive health in canines and human beings, helping to promote regular bowel movements and ease digestive upset.
A study of Labrador Dogs published in Animal Nutrition and Feed Technology found support for the prebiotic and gut health benefits of Jerusalem artichoke [6].

How to Serve Power Foods Complete?
Power Foods Complete can be served directly into your dog’s bowl, without requiring added water, heating, or refrigeration. Refer to the Feeding Guidelines chart to determine the correct daily amount for the weight of your dog.
When transitioning your dog to the new food, you should do so gradually so they become accustomed to it. Serve 10% of the food on the first two days, 25% on days three and four, 50% on days five and six, 75% on days seven and eight, and 100% on day nine and forward.

Q: How does the guaranteed analysis compare to the dry matter and calorie-weighted analysis for this product?
A: The guaranteed analysis is the typical standard on pet food labels, like for Power Foods Complete, which lists protein and fat at 35%. However, the dry matter analysis removes moisture content and offers a clearer view of the food’s nutritional breakdown, with protein rising to 40%.
The calorie-weighted analysis looks at how calories are distributed in protein, fat, and carbs, with Power Foods Complete providing 27% of its calories from protein, 65% from fat, and 8% from carbohydrates. Each approach provides a different perspective to help you assess what’s best for your dog’s health, energy, and diet.

Q: How long does Power Foods Complete last?
A: An unopened bag lasts 12-18 months when stored in a cool, dry place. Once opened, use it within 6 weeks for best freshness. The air-dried process helps it last longer than fresh food but shorter than traditional kibble. Always check the expiration date.
